Hibernate 注解方式 save后获取不到对象id一种情况
来源:互联网 发布:云计算峰会的会议定位 编辑:程序博客网 时间:2024/05/21 02:52
一般来讲save会自增主键并将主键值赋回对象本身
因为先写sql创建表,表里面设了自增,save后表里主键倒是对的,对象本身主键值没有改变,还一直是0,
后来发现是注解里@id下面没写自增类型,加上@GeneratedValue(strategy=GenerationType.IDENTITY)就好了,对象的主键值也能被赋值
总结:JavaBean里主键需要有自增注解,save产生的主键值才能被赋回
新手之漏,还望莫笑。
0 0
- Hibernate 注解方式 save后获取不到对象id一种情况
- hibernate save 后实体对象不会注销
- 关于Jquery append 动态添加元素后,获取不到元素对象情况
- Hibernate 在事务管理下,save之后获取Id的方法
- (九)Hibernate之有关Hibernate升级后注解方式的对象关系映射
- Android获取不到ID
- 添加@Transactional后获取不到类前的注解
- Hibernate 保存之后获取对象ID
- spring 中getHibernateTemplate().save(t) 后如何获取添加后的id
- Hibernate 和 JPA 注解方式自定义ID生成器
- Hibernate ID 注解
- hibernate中双向关联在级联情况下save对象讨论
- hibernate对象的三种状态以及插完一条数据后立刻获取到该条数据id
- yii 数据save后得到插入id
- SSM实现insert对象后 立马获取对象ID
- 获取不到方法的注解
- Hibernate 使用 Generic 方式获取 Bean 对象
- JPA Save()对象后返回该对象在数据库中的ID的解决方法(亲测有效)
- Eclipse:Error:could not find java SE Runtime Environment/Error: could not find java.dll
- 浅析HTTP协议
- linux常用命令----文本格式化输出
- No enclosing instance of type E is accessible. Must qualify the allocation with an enclosing instanc
- 【水题】高精度加法
- Hibernate 注解方式 save后获取不到对象id一种情况
- http(3)详解------Web的结构组件
- 关于在Java学习中遇到的浮躁
- android 中自定义广播的使用broardcast
- CSS总结(1)
- 解决Android中LayoutParam宽高的单位设置问题
- Android API Guides 阅读笔记(6)----Task and Back Stack
- VS2012启用SQLite的Data Provider
- leetCode(52):Add Binary